Subject: [PATCH 0/2] Use libopcodes disassembler styling with GDB
Date: Fri, 17 Jun 2022 11:36:00 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<cover.1655462053.git.aburgess@redhat.com> (raw)

libopcodes is slowly gaining the ability to provide styling
information for its disassembler output.

This series extends GDB to make use of this information where possible
(currently only i386 based architectures and RISC-V).
